#7fba91 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7fba91 is composed of 49.8% red, 72.9%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 22%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 138.3 degrees, a saturation of 29.9% and a lightness of 61.4%. #7fba91 color hex could be obtained by blending #feffff with #007523.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

Shades and Tints of #7fba91

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070c08 is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#7fba91

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#96a39a is the less saturated color, while #3bfe76 is the most saturated one.
